Aero-India, a biennial air show being held at Bengaluru
Sri Lankan armed forces personnel to watch it in Colombo
Read moreSri Lankan armed forces personnel to watch it in Colombo
Read more© 2020 NewsIn.Asia - Lovingly maintained by DigitalArc.
© 2020 NewsIn.Asia - Lovingly maintained by DigitalArc.